If you're under 18 and you're being abused literally, sexually, emotionally, or with neglect the specialist is required by legislation to alert kid safety services in the location where the misuse happened. This law likewise uses to susceptible or reliant individuals, such as older adults. For example, if you're age 65 or over and you're being abused or ignored, the specialist is required to report it to authorities.


In several states, therapists are not needed to report adult-on-adult attack or battery, consisting of if the acts are between partners or spouses. perinatal depression therapist. Instead, the specialist might help the mistreated partner thought of a plan to stay safe, which may include running away the scenario. https://www.intensedebate.com/people/w3llmndprntl. Whether a therapist reports a criminal offense relies on if the crime was committed in the past, is recurring, or is mosting likely to happen in the future

For example, if you tell your therapist that you swiped a television in 2014, that info is safeguarded by privacy guidelines. When it involves existing criminal offenses or future crimes the customer reports meaning to take part in, the therapist has to report it if the criminal activity worries others' immediate safety. Specialist privacy allows you to really feel risk-free enough to share your exclusive info during treatment.


A few of these instances are delegated the specialist's discernment. In other a lot more major scenarios, therapists are legally bound to keep the customer or others risk-free. As a whole, therapists are called for to keep every little thing you state in self-confidence with the exception of the adhering to situations: intended suicide intent intended violence in the direction of otherspast, existing, or prepared youngster abuse senior or reliant adult abuseSome states have also stricter legislations to shield your privacy.

A qualified therapist collaborating with a person that struggles with anxiousness might, for instance, give the person with different therapeutic methods that they can use to prevent a pending anxiety attack. Or they could offer a patient with alcoholism a set collection of actions to comply with when they feel a food craving coming on.


Therapists, however, take a slightly various technique to mental health treatment. They work to help their patients address comparable concerns, and commonly supply the exact same advice that therapists might. Nonetheless, a crucial difference is that therapists usually look for to go deeper by helping the client recognize the just how and why behind a challenge.

Counseling is commonly (though not always) a short-term technique, equipping the patient with tools they can place right into activity instantly to start living an extra healthy and balanced life. Therapy, on the other hand, is often a longer-term procedure that can last months and even years as the specialist and client look for the origin of the concerns being addressed to make long lasting adjustment.


While the called for education and learning levels for these various settings overlap, there are some therapy qualifications that do not require postgraduate degrees (perinatal depression therapist san francisco). Some states accredit dependencies counselors with an associate degree, or a combination of college credit ratings, professional seminars, and years of specialist experience functioning in dependency. Nevertheless, if you want to end up being a certified mental wellness therapist or have a personal practice, you must gain a master's level to get licensure.
